North American fish extinctions may double by 2050
« on: August 22, 2012, 01:00:22 PM »

"From 1900 to 2010, freshwater fish species in North America went extinct at a rate 877 times faster than the rate found in the fossil record, and estimates indicate the rate may double by 2050."
